What Is Power Washing?
Power washing uses controlled high-pressure water to blast away deep dirt, grime, algae, and stains from durable surfaces like concrete, pavers, and wood.

How Often Should You Power Wash?
In Oregon’s damp climate, driveways, walkways, and other hard surfaces should be professionally cleaned about every 12 months. Regular power washing helps:
- Prevent algae and moss from making surfaces slick and unsafe
- Reduce long-term staining and discoloration
- Protect concrete and wood from premature wear and deterioration
For heavily shaded or high-traffic areas, more frequent cleaning may be recommended.
